    四针状氧化锌晶须对硅橡胶泡沫材料性能的影响

    Effects of Tetrapod-Like Zinc Oxide Whiskers on Properties of Silicone Rubber Foam Composites

    • 摘要: 研究了四针状氧化锌晶须对硅橡胶泡沫材料的组织结构、力学和压缩应力松弛性能等的影响.结果表明:四针状氧化锌晶须的加入可以明显提高硅橡胶泡沫材料的密度、硬度和拉伸强度,降低其泡孔的尺寸,优化泡孔的分布;且随加入量的增多,其效果越明显;该材料的压缩应力松弛性能随四针状氧化锌晶须的加入有明显的降低,且加入量越多,降低也越明显.

       

      Abstract: The effects of tetrapod-like zinc oxide whiskers(T-ZnOw)on microstructure,mechanical properties and compressive stress relaxation properties of the silicone rubber foam composites were studied.The results show that the density,hardness and tensile strength of the silicone rubber were increased remarkably with the addition of tetrapod-like zinc oxide whiskers,the average cell diameter size of the composites was reduced.The distribution of the cells was optimized,and the more the addition,the more obvious the increase.The compress stress relaxation properties of the composite were decreased remarkably with the use of the T-ZnOw,and the more the addition,the more obvious the decrease.
